Abstract

본 발명은 건축용 내ㆍ외장재에 관한 것으로 보다 상세하게는 각종 건축물의 내벽 또는 외벽의 마감시공에 사용되어 건축물의 내ㆍ외벽을 미려하게 장식함과 아울러, 벽체를 보호하는 건축 외장재용 복합 판넬에 관한 것이다. The present invention relates to a building interior and exterior materials, and more particularly, to a composite panel for building exterior materials used to finish the interior or exterior walls of various buildings to decorate the interior and exterior walls of buildings and to protect walls. will be.

본 발명의 건축 외장재용 복합 판넬은 베이스플레이트(Base Plate)를 중심으로 일 측에는 외부 마감재가, 타 측에는 방음/단열재가 결합되되, 상기 베이스플레이트(Base Plate)에 윈도우(Window)가 형성되고, 상기 윈도우(Window) 부위에 외부 마감재가 안치되어 상기 외부마감재와 베이스플레이트(Base Plate)가 방음/단열재와 직접 접착, 결합된 것을 특징으로 한다.Composite panel for building exterior material of the present invention is the outer plate finishing on one side, the soundproof / heat insulating material is coupled to the other side around the base plate (Base Plate), the window is formed on the base plate (Base Plate), The outer finishing material is placed in the window portion, the outer finishing material and the base plate (Base Plate) is characterized in that the direct bonding, combined with the soundproof / insulation.

본 발명에 따른 건축 외장재용 복합 판넬 및 그 제조방법은 판넬 제조 시 접착제 사용이 필요 없기 때문에 제조공정이 간편하고, 제조 능율을 향상시킬 수 있을 뿐만 아니라, 환경 및 작업환경을 개선할 수 있는 효과가 있다. The composite panel for building exterior material according to the present invention and the manufacturing method thereof do not require the use of adhesives in the manufacture of the panel, making the manufacturing process simple, improving production yield, and improving the environment and working environment. have.

Description

건축 외장재용 복합 판넬{Composition panel for exterior of building}  Composition panel for exterior of building

본 발명은 건축용 내ㆍ외장재에 관한 것으로 보다 상세하게는 각종 건축물의 내벽 또는 외벽의 마감시공에 사용되어 건축물의 내부 벽면 또는 외부 벽면을 미려하게 장식함과 아울러, 벽체를 보호하는 건축 외장재용 복합 판넬에 관한 것이다.The present invention relates to a building interior and exterior materials, and more specifically, to be used for the finishing of the interior or exterior walls of various buildings to decorate the interior or exterior walls of the building beautifully, as well as to protect the wall composite panel for building exterior materials It is about.

일반적으로 각종 건축물에는 외벽 및 내벽의 외관을 미려하게 장식함과 아울러, 벽체를 보호하기 위한 외장재가 시공된다. 이러한 외장재는 알루미늄, 스텐레스, 아연강판 등과 같은 금속재, 천연 또는 인조 대리석과 같은 석재, 유리를 포함하는 세라믹재, 합성수지재, 목재 등 다양한 재질을 복합적으로 사용하여 다양한 형상과 색상의 복합판넬을 제작하여 사용하고 있다.In general, various buildings are provided with exterior materials for beautifully decorating the exterior of the outer wall and the inner wall, and to protect the wall. This exterior material is made of a composite panel of various shapes and colors by using a variety of materials such as metal materials such as aluminum, stainless steel, zinc steel sheet, stone such as natural or artificial marble, ceramic material including glass, synthetic resin, wood, etc. I use it.

건축 외장재용 복합 판넬은 주로 벽체에 고정되는 베이스플레이트(Base Plate)와 그 위에 형성되는 방음/단열재 그리고 방음/단열재 위에 외부 마감재를 구비하는 형태와, 베이스플레이트(Base Plate)를 중심으로 일 측면에는 외부 마감재를, 그리고 타 측면에는 방음/단열재를 구비하는 형태가 사용되고 있다. The composite panel for building exterior materials is mainly provided with a base plate fixed to a wall, a sound insulation / insulation material formed thereon, and an external finishing material on the sound insulation / insulation material, and on one side of the base plate. External finishes, and sound insulation / insulation material on the other side are used.

그러나, 상기 베이스플레이트(Base Plate)가 벽체에 고정되는 형태의 건축 외장재용 복합 판넬은 실제 시공 시 벽체에 베이스플레이트를 고정시키기 위해 못이나 나사 등 고정수단의 사용이 불가피한데 이 때 판넬 자체에 손상을 주어 시공 불량이 일어나는 문제점을 가지고 있다. However, the composite panel for building exterior materials in which the base plate is fixed to the wall is inevitable to use a fixing means such as nails or screws to fix the base plate to the wall during actual construction. Given the problem of construction failure occurs.

반면, 상기 후자의 건축 외장재용 복합 판넬은 시공 시 일어나는 시공불량의 문제점은 해결하였으나, 판넬 제조 시 외부 마감재를 베이스플레이트에 부착하기 위하여는 접착제의 사용이 불가피한데 이에 따른 추가공정이 필요하고, 접착공정의 추가도입으로 인해 제조공정이 복잡해지고 제조비용이 상승될 뿐만 아니라, 환경오염 및 작업환경이 열악해지는 문제점을 안고 있다. On the other hand, the latter composite panel for building exterior materials solved the problem of poor construction during construction, but in order to attach the external finishing material to the base plate when manufacturing the panel, the use of an adhesive is inevitable, and additional processes are required accordingly. Further introduction of the process not only increases the manufacturing process and increases the manufacturing cost, but also has a problem of environmental pollution and poor working environment.

본 발명은 상기와 같은 종래 기술의 문제점을 해결하려는 것으로서, 베이스플레이트(Base Plate)를 중심으로 일 측에는 외부 마감재가, 그리고 타 측면에는 방음/단열재가 결합된 건축 외장재용 복합 판넬에 있어서, 상기 외부 마감재를 결합시키기 위한 별도의 접착공정이 필요 없는 건축 외장재용 복합 판넬 및 그 제조방법을 제공하려는 것이다. The present invention is to solve the problems of the prior art as described above, in the composite panel for building exterior materials combined with an outer finishing material on one side, and the soundproof / insulation on the other side of the base plate, the outer It is to provide a composite panel for building exterior materials and a method of manufacturing the same that does not require a separate bonding process for bonding the finish.

   상기 본 발명의 목적 달성을 위한 건축 외장재용 복합 판넬은 베이스플레이트(Base Plate)를 중심으로 일 측에는 외부 마감재가, 타 측면에는 방음/단열재가 결합되되, 상기 베이스플레이트(Base Plate)에 윈도우(Window)가 형성되고, 상기 윈도우(Window) 부위에 외부 마감재가 안치되어 상기 외부마감재와 베이스플레이트(Base Plate)가 방음/단열재와 직접 접착, 결합된 것을 특징으로 한다. The composite panel for building exterior material for achieving the object of the present invention is the outer plate on one side of the base plate (Base Plate), the soundproof / heat insulating material is coupled to the other side, the window on the base plate (Window) ) Is formed, and the external finish is placed in the window portion, the external finish and the base plate (base plate) is characterized in that the direct adhesive, combined with the sound insulation / insulation.

본 발명의 상기 건축 외장재용 복합 판넬은 베이스플레이트(Base Plate)에 형성된 윈도우(Window) 부위에 외부마감재를 안치시키고 그 이면에 발포성 합성수지를 발포시킨 방음/단열재 층을 형성시킴으로써 합성수지의 발포 시의 접착력에 의해 윈도우를 통해 노출된 외부마감재와 방음/단열재인 발포합성수지를 직접 접착, 결합시킬 수 있다. The composite panel for the building exterior material of the present invention has the adhesive force at the time of foaming of the synthetic resin by forming a soundproof / insulation layer of foamed foamed synthetic resin on the back side of the outer finishing material in the window (Window) formed on the base plate (Base Plate) It is possible to directly bond and bond the external finishing material exposed through the window and the foamed synthetic resin, which is a sound insulation / insulation.

본 발명에 따른 건축 외장재용 복합 판넬 및 그 제조방법은 시공 시 일어나는 시공불량의 문제점을 해결할 수 있는 효과가 있고, Composite panel for a building exterior material according to the present invention and its manufacturing method has an effect that can solve the problems of poor construction occurs during construction,

판넬 제조 시 접착제 사용이 필요 없기 때문에 제조공정이 간편하고, 제조Easy manufacturing process because no adhesive is required for panel manufacturing

능율을 향상시킬 수 있을 뿐만 아니라, 환경 및 작업환경을 개선할 수 있는Not only can it improve the performance, but it can also improve the environment and work environment.

효과가 있다. It works.

이하 본 발명에 따른 건축 외장재용 복합 판넬을 첨부된 도면을 참조하여 구체적으로 설명한다. 본 발명에서 건축 외장재용 복합 판넬은 각종 건축물의 내부 벽면 또는 외부 벽면을 장식 및 보호하기 위하여 시공되는 외장재용 복합 판넬을 의미한다.Hereinafter will be described in detail with reference to the accompanying drawings, the composite panel for building exterior material according to the present invention. In the present invention, the composite panel for building exterior material means a composite panel for exterior material which is constructed to decorate and protect the inner wall or the outer wall of various buildings.

도1은 윈도우가 형성된 베이스플레이트(20)와 상기 윈도우부위에 안치되는 외부마감재(10)의 일 실시예에 따른 사시도이고,1 is a perspective view according to an embodiment of a base plate 20 having a window formed therein and an outer finish material 10 placed on the window portion;

도2는 베이스플레이트(20)의 윈도우의 하부에 외부마감재(10)를 안치시킨 상태도이며,2 is a state diagram in which the external finish material 10 is placed in the lower part of the window of the base plate 20,

도3은 본 발명의 일 시시예에 따른 건축 외장재용 복합 판넬의 단면도이다.Figure 3 is a cross-sectional view of a composite panel for building exterior material according to an embodiment of the present invention.

도4A 및 4B는 본 발명의 건축 외장재용 복합 판넬 제조방법을 설명하기 위한 성형틀 및 성형된 복합판넬의 단면도를 보여주고 있다. 4A and 4B show cross-sectional views of a molding frame and a molded composite panel for explaining a method for manufacturing a composite panel for building exterior material of the present invention.

본 발명에 따른 건축 외장재용 복합 판넬의 외부마감재(10)는 천연 또는 인조 대리석이나 화강석과 같은 석재, 유리를 포함하는 세라믹재, 합성수지재 또는 목재와 같은 재질로 형성할 수 있으나, 건물 외부용일 경우에는 석재나 세라믹재가 바람직하고, 건물 내부용일 경우에는 목재나 합성수지재도 사용할 수 있다. 본 발명에서 외부 마감재는 상기 석재, 세라믹재, 합성수지재 또는 목재 중에서 바람직한 어느 1종을 선택하여 사용하거나, 또는 2종 이상을 선택하여 사용할 수도 있다.The exterior finish material 10 of the composite panel for building exterior material according to the present invention may be formed of a material such as natural or artificial marble or granite stone, a ceramic material including glass, a synthetic resin material or wood, but for the exterior of the building In the case of stone or ceramic material is preferable, for the interior of the building, wood or synthetic resin material can also be used. In the present invention, the external finishing material may be used by selecting any one of the above-mentioned stone, ceramic material, synthetic resin material or wood, or two or more types.

상기 외부마감재(10)는 임의의 다양한 형상 및 색상으로 형성할 수 있으며,중량을 감안하면 그 형상은 타일형상이 바람직하고, 그 두께는 3미리미터(mm) ~ 30미리미터(mm)의 정도가 바람직하다.The external finish material 10 may be formed in any of various shapes and colors, considering the weight of the shape is preferably a tile shape, the thickness is about 3mm (mm) ~ 30mm (mm) degree Is preferred.

본 발명에서 외부마감재(10)의 이면은 흡음/단열재와의 접착면적을 넓혀 접착력을 극대화할 수 있도록 요철면으로 형성할 수 있다. In the present invention, the rear surface of the external finish material 10 may be formed as a concave-convex surface to maximize the adhesive force by widening the adhesive area with the sound absorbing / insulating material.

본 발명에 따른 건축 외장재용 복합 판넬를 구성하는 베이스플레이트(20)는 외부마감재와 흡음/단열재를 지지하는 지지플레이트로서 금속재 플레이트, 천연 또는 합성 목재 플레이트, 합성수지재 플레이트 등을 사용할 수 있으나, 건물의 외부용으로는 장식적 측면이나 내구성 측면에서 금속재 플레이트가 바람직하고, 내부용으로는 목재가 바람직하다. 금속재 플레이트로서는 함석이나 알루미늄과 같은 연성의 금속플레이트가 특히 바람직하다. The base plate 20 constituting the composite panel for building exterior material according to the present invention may be a metal plate, natural or synthetic wood plate, synthetic resin plate, etc. as a support plate for supporting the external finishing material and sound absorbing / insulating material, but outside the building For the use, a metal plate is preferable in terms of decoration or durability, and wood is preferred for internal use. As the metal plate, soft metal plates such as tin and aluminum are particularly preferable.

본 발명에 따른 건축 외장재용 복합 판넬은 상기 베이스플레이트(20)에 윈도우(22)가 형성되는 것을 특징으로 한다. 베이스플레이트(20)에 윈도우(22)를 형성함으로써 접착제의 사용 없이 외부마감재를 흡음/단열재와 직접 접착시켜 결합시킬 수 있다. Composite panel for building exterior material according to the invention is characterized in that the window 22 is formed on the base plate (20). By forming the window 22 on the base plate 20, the external finishing material can be directly bonded to the sound absorbing / insulating material without the use of an adhesive.

베이스플레이트(20)에 형성되는 윈도우(22)는 그 부위에 안치되는 외부마감재(10)의 형상과 동일 형상이 바람직하고, 그 사이즈(size)는 외부마감재(10)에 의해 완전히 가려 막히고 덮이는 사이즈, 즉, 외부마감재(10) 사이즈보다 크지 않은 사이즈가 바람직하다.The window 22 formed on the base plate 20 is preferably the same shape as the shape of the external finish material 10 placed in the site, the size of which is completely blocked by the external finish material 10 and covered and covered. Is preferably a size that is not larger than the size of the external finish material 10.

윈도우(22)의 형상을 그 부위에 안치되는 외부마감재(10)의 이면의 형상과 동일형상으로 형성함으로써 방음/단열재(30)와의 접착면적을 극대화할 수 있고, 그 사이즈(size)를 외부마감재가 완전히 차폐할 수 있는 크기로 형성함으로써 방음/단열재 형성 시 발포 합성수지(30)가 외부마감재(10) 측, 즉, 외부로 돌출 형성되는 것을 방지할 수 있다.By forming the shape of the window 22 in the same shape as the shape of the back surface of the external finishing material 10 placed in the site, it is possible to maximize the adhesive area with the soundproof / insulating material 30, the size (size) of the external finishing material By forming a size that can be completely shielded, it is possible to prevent the foamed synthetic resin 30 from protruding to the outside of the outer finishing material 10 side, that is, when forming the sound insulation / insulation.

본 발명에 따른 건축 외장재용 복합 판넬를 구성하는 방음/단열재(30)는 발포성 폴리스틸렌, 발포성 폴리우레탄 등과 같은 발포성 합성수지로 통상적인 발포성형 방법에 의해 발포시켜 형성할 수 있다.The sound insulation / insulation material 30 constituting the composite panel for the building exterior material according to the present invention may be formed by foaming by a conventional foaming method with a foamable synthetic resin such as foamable polystyrene, foamable polyurethane, or the like.

본 발명의 상기 건축 외장재용 복합 판넬은 외부마감재(10) 및 베이스플레이트(20)를 준비하는 단계; 상기 베이스플레이트(20)에 윈도우(22)를 형성하는 단계; 상기 외부마감재(10)를 성형틀(100)에 배열하는 단계; 상기 배열된 외부마감재(10) 위에 베이스플레이트(20)를 안치시키는 단계; 상기 베이스플레이트(20)의 윈도우(22)를 통해 노출된 외부마감재(10) 및 베이스플레이트(20) 위에 발포성 합성수지를 발포시켜 방음/단열재(30) 층을 형성시키는 단계를 포함하는 제조방법에 의해 제조할 수 있다. The composite panel for building exterior material of the present invention comprises the steps of preparing an external finish material 10 and the base plate 20; Forming a window (22) on the base plate (20); Arranging the outer finish material (10) in a molding die (100); Placing the base plate 20 on the arranged outer finish material 10; Foaming a foamed synthetic resin on the outer finishing material 10 and the base plate 20 exposed through the window 22 of the base plate 20 to form a sound insulation / insulation 30 layer by a manufacturing method It can manufacture.

본 발명의 상기 건축 외장재용 복합 판넬의 제조방법에서 외부마감재(10)를 성형틀(100)에 배열하는 방법은 미리 성형틀에 외부마감재가 배열될 위치를 표시한 다음, 그 표시 위치에 외부마감재를 배열(도4A 참조)하거나, 또는 윈도우(22)가 형성된 베이스플레이트(20)와 동일형상의 외부마감재 배열판(120)을 성형틀에 안치시키고 외부마감재(10)를 외부마감재 배열판(120)에 형성된 윈도우(122) 위치에 배열(도4B 참조)함으로써 외부마감재와 베이스플레이트(20)의 윈도우(22) 부위를 정확히 일치시킬 수 있다. In the method of manufacturing the composite panel for building exterior materials of the present invention, the method of arranging the external finishing material 10 on the molding die 100 indicates the position in which the external finishing material is arranged on the molding die in advance, and then displays the external finishing material at the display position. (See Fig. 4A) or the outer finisher array plate 120 having the same shape as the base plate 20 on which the window 22 is formed is placed in the molding frame and the outer finisher 10 is placed on the outer finisher array plate 120. By arranging (see Fig. 4B) the position of the window 122 formed in the (), it is possible to exactly match the portion of the window 22 of the outer finish material and the base plate 20.

외부마감재 배열판(120)은 베이스플레이트(20)와 동일 사이즈로 구성하고, 윈도우(122)의 사이즈는 외부마감재(10)가 착탈될수 있는 사이즈가 바람직하다.The external finishing material array plate 120 is configured in the same size as the base plate 20, the size of the window 122 is preferably a size that the external finishing material 10 can be removable.

본 발명의 상기 건축 외장재용 복합 판넬은 외부마감재를 다양한 형상과 색상으로 제조하여 건축물의 외벽 또는 내벽을 장식하고 보호하는데 유용하게 사용될 수 있다. The composite panel for the building exterior material of the present invention can be usefully used to decorate and protect the exterior wall or the interior wall of the building by manufacturing the exterior finish in a variety of shapes and colors.
